You don't need to take the two extracts at the same time. Basically you just want to find a source of oligomeric proanthocyanidins (OPCs) that works for you and isn't too expensive. Pycnogenol (trademarked French maritime pine bark extract) can be really pricey... the least expensive I found was Trader Darwin's you can get at Trader Joe's grocery stores. Solaray has "Tru-OPCs" from grape seed extracted by Dr. Masquelier's process and might be a good deal. Then again I didn't notice any effect from taking Pycnogenol. Dr. Amen says some people have had success with it.

If you are getting good sleep and don't have dark circles under your eyes you probably don't need to drink licorice tea for the glycyrrhizin, which inhibits cortisol breakdown. Drinking it daily for much longer than a month can result in hypertension (too much cortisol!).

You'll need to conquer your sweets craving somehow and avoid caffiene as well. Caffiene constricts the blood vessels in the brain, so it literally cuts down on the amount of fuel and raw materials your brain can uptake.
